EFF office occupation condemned

BOSSES of the Eastern Cape Freedom Fighters (EFF) have opened a criminal case against a disgruntled group which forcefully moved into the party’s headquarters in King William’s Town on Monday.

EFF coordinator Vuyisile Schoeman and provincial convener Simcelile Rubela laid the complaint with the King William’s Town police after the EFF group stormed the party’s offices demanding keys and documentation.

Schoeman said the party opened a case of trespassing and theft.

He said: “These people left with keys and the party documentation.  There is more security in the premises now and locks have been changed.”

King William’s Town police spokes-woman Lieutenant Siphokazi Mawisa confirmed a case of intimidation was opened.

EFF members led by Andile Matshaya, who claimed to be the provincial spokesman, occupied the premises and demanded keys and documentation from a receptionist, who was visibly shaking.

They then held a press conference to announce a new EFF structure to be led by the party’s legislature leader, Themba Wele.

Wele, however, condemned the actions of his supporters saying this was not “the proper route”.

“They should have written to the national structure for their grievances to be heard,” Wele said.

The actions of the dissenting group had triggered an intervention from the national structure.

“EFF is for the poor. It’s for the community of the Eastern Cape and the whole country meaning that each and every member of this party deserves to be listened to when they have a problem. It comes as a shock to me that there are people who were rejected (EFF) membership because they came from the DA,” Wele said.

However, Schoeman accused Wele of inciting the disgruntled members.

“These people are being handled by Wele. He is the one giving them instructions.  Our leadership is intact. It is not shaken,” he said.
